Unless your replacing the insert with a gen I don't think there's any point. You might consider just changing the pearl with a Watchmaterial pearl for an improvement.
Use a dental pick or similar and pick at the pearl until you can get it out. To remove the whole insert, heat it up with a hair dryer softening the adhesive, then using the hole the pearl was in...just lift off the insert...very easy.
I replaced the insert with a gen insert on this watch for a friend recently. The gen needed a tiny bit of sanding to fit.
